Zavala is a small village on the sunniest side of Hvar with a small harbour, a few restaurants, bakery and a small market. Be sure to visit Hvar OldTown, a proof of Hvar’s rich cultural history with 13th century walls and a hilltop fortress. The main square houses an impressive Renaissance Cathedral which can be admired from one of many cafés serving authentic, unpretentious yet true Dalmatian delicacy most likely incorporating in someway local olives and delicious regional wine. And even though Hvar has been on the tourist radar for quite some time attracting A-Listers from around the world it continues to be an example of undisturbed landscape and us living in harmony with nature.
